Default Using Track Changes - How do I renumber Footnotes in Document?

Hi,
I am using track changes in a word document and I need to delete one of the
footnotes. When I delete the footnote, why doesn't it renumber the other
footnotes automatically? Isn't there a way for the number to change without
going in and manually doing this?

Any help would be appreciated. I am using Microsoft Office 2003.
